1: Batman: Arkham Asylum - 360 - 10pts
- Awesome game, not because it's Batman, but simply because as a game it works so well, great gameplay, cool story. Win!


2: Shadow Complex - 360 XBLA - 7pts
- Finally i get to play one of these epic Super Metroid/ Castlevania type exploration games at a time of release...rather than having to look back many years later and find out what the hype was about. Great game, possibly the best XBLA game of 2009 for me.


3: Wii Sports Resort - Wii - 4pts
- From a technical stand point, this game isn't as groundbreaking and amazing as Wii Sports originally was, however! With friends, this is a great multiplayer game, and technically a good complete play through of everything, and the new range of events gives this game more legs to last longer (in theory) than Wii Sports did.

Well, WiiWare has had Gradius Rebirth and recently Contra Rebirth, both games featuring new content but in the classic NES/SNES style graphics; this Castlevania game is apparently titled Castlevania Adventures, the same title as a 1989 GameBoy game, so no-one's quite sure what to expect, yet.
